(CNN) Businessman Tom Steyer struck at former Vice President Joe Biden and former South Bend, Indiana, Mayor Pete Buttigieg in a new ad launched Thursday, the first explicitly negative ad his campaign has aired against his Democratic presidential rivals. Steyer has spent more than $170 million on advertising during his campaign, powered by his personal fortune of roughly $1.6 billion. Steyer's aggressive ad spending -- dwarfing the entire Democratic field's spending combined, excluding Steyer's fellow billionaire, Michael Bloomberg -- has prompted sharp criticism from his rivals. Steyer has responded to the criticism, saying he's less well known than his rivals and needs to get his message out.
